What is the difference between Entry Level Insurance Underwriter vs Insurance Claims Adjuster?

AspectEntry Level Insurance UnderwriterInsurance Claims Adjuster
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or bachelor’s; some certifications (e.g., CPCU) beneficialHigh school diploma or bachelor’s; licensing may be required
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, analyzing applications and risk factorsField and office work, investigating claims
Industry UsageInsurance companies, underwriting departmentsInsurance companies, claims departments
Common Search/ComparisonEntry Level Insurance Underwriter vs Insurance Claims Adjuster

While both roles are vital in the insurance industry, an Entry Level Insurance Underwriter primarily assesses risk and approves policies, whereas an Insurance Claims Adjuster investigates and settles claims. Both positions require strong analytical skills and industry knowledge, but they focus on different stages of the insurance process.

What qualifications do you need to be an entry level insurance underwriter?

Entry level insurance underwriters typically need a bachelor's degree in fields such as finance, economics, or business.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and familiarity with insurance policies and underwriting software are also important. Some employers may prefer candidates with internships or related experience in insurance or risk assessment.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level insurance underwriters, and how can they be overcome?

Entry level insurance underwriters often encounter challenges such as learning to assess risk accurately with limited experience, keeping up with ever-changing regulations, and managing a high volume of applications within tight deadlines. Overcoming these challenges involves actively seeking mentorship from senior underwriters, participating in ongoing training programs offered by employers, and developing strong organizational skills. Collaborating closely with colleagues in claims, sales, and actuarial departments also helps new underwriters gain a broader perspective and make more informed decisions.

What does an entry level insurance underwriter do?

An entry level insurance underwriter reviews applications for insurance coverage and evaluates the risks involved in insuring people or assets. They analyze information such as financial data, health records, and other relevant documents to determine if the applicant meets the company's guidelines. Their responsibilities also include making recommendations on coverage amounts, premiums, and policy terms under the supervision of more experienced underwriters. This role is essential for making sure insurance companies issue policies that are both fair to the customer and profitable for the business.
